This section proposes a standard circuit breaker: closed under normal operation, open after a failure-rate threshold is crossed within a rolling window, and half-open after a cooldown to probe recovery. Probes are limited to a small concurrent budget so a flapping upstream isn't overwhelmed. State transitions emit metrics for the on-call dashboard. Reviewers should focus on the threshold interactions, since the proposed defaults are as follows.

tuning table, kajog-bawip:
TIERS = {
    "kelius": 256,
    "lammir": 543,
}

## Changelog — BranchGroom 5.1.0

The setting previously called `BG_AUTH` has been renamed to `BRANCHGROOM_REAPER_SECRET` to make its purpose obvious during support audits. BranchGroom is our stale-branch cleanup bot, and the old name caused repeated confusion with the unrelated `BG_AUTH_MODE` flag. Both names are accepted through 5.2, after which the legacy key is removed entirely. Support should walk customers through editing their deployment env file and placing the renamed entry on the line that follows.

env line for fafof-fahag: LEDGER_TOKEN5=f8790

Gallery Label Transfer — Wrenfield Museum Annex. The printed labels for the new Stonelight Gallery must travel in the archival folder, kept flat and dry. Records team signs the release sheet before dispatch and photographs the folder seal. No substitutions of labels in transit. At collection, the courier is to be told precisely this:

dispatch memo: the eliath belael courier leaves the praox ledger at gate 8841 under passcode 017589

**Alert: BranchSweeper stuck**

Heads up: this fires when our stale-branch cleanup bot, BranchSweeper, hasn't completed a sweep in 48 hours. Usually it's just rate-limited or choking on a repo with thousands of dead branches. Check the sweeper logs first; a restart fixes most cases. If it keeps flapping, drop a note to the tooling folks at the address below.

pager mailbox: silael.sorwyn.tamius@zemvarsys.corp

Hi Marek,

Quick handover before I'm off. The FeedWright podcast validator is mostly stable, but the RSS namespace checks throw false positives on enclosures with odd MIME types — there's an open ticket. As the new contractor, skim the validator rules in `checks/` first; they're self-documenting-ish. Deploys go out Tuesdays. If you get stuck or the queue backs up, reach out to the feeds team at this address.

escalation mailbox, bafog-fafog: ulador@paliqlabs.internal